Germán Jabloñski

Results 133 comments of Germán Jabloñski

2 solutions come to mind: 1. A way to automate the serialization of any node, like this https://github.com/facebook/lexical/pull/3931 2. Add importYjs/exportYjs methods. I think solution 2 is unavoidable, since even...

Yeah. There is a similar PR with a "generic" clone that was ready to be merged but it seems the Lexical team hasn't had the time. As soon as that...

Contributing to the traceability of this discussion. In the past there have been several issues and PRs seeking to determine which properties should be excluded in yjs. For reference, see:...

Update: I correct myself again. I think ideally a decorator would actually have an `export/importYjs` method. In case it is not user defined, it could fallback to `export/importJSON`. The reason...

> # Why nested editor is not a good idea? > 1. Moving contents between editors is painful. > You can't directly move nodes between editors. Serialization is mandatory and...

> The **current** HistoryStateEntry doesn't track timestamps, and the debouncing in the **current** implementation wouldn't be able to merge entries from multiple editors. Exactly, the "current". But it is a...

Sure, but despite everything I still don't understand what problem a "DecoratorElementNode" would solve. The only problem I see is that of the undomanager, which seems obvious that it should...

As [discussed here](https://github.com/facebook/lexical/issues/4912), yjs serialization should ideally be given by `importJson` or `exportJson`. Once that's done, [the recommended way](https://lexical.dev/docs/concepts/serialization#versioning--breaking-changes) to make this backward compatible would be in the serialization methods.

### I care a lot: - [x] Smaller ranges in "yearly income." - [ ] Work modality (fully remote, hybrid, in-person). ### I care a little: - [ ] Weekly...